Regarding programming, I would say my answer would be yes to all of your questions. I think all of those feelings and pleasures can exist simultaneously.

Though, I believe you are touching on a point that is common in Buddhism. Attachment leads to suffering. Many of us, myself included, are attached to the identity of being a programmer. I would by lying if I said I did not have bittersweet feelings about the future. But I try to always remind myself about the impermanence of everything in the universe. Even if LLMs never existed, there would be a day when I write my final line of code. The day may come sooner than I once imagined, but it was always destined.

I think it is important to be mindful of the present as well. I can still program currently. I was programming minutes before righting this comment. Thus, it is imperative that I spend some time relishing in the fact that I still am healthy and capable enough to program. I have not been replaced yet. I still feel an abundance of gratitude and satisfaction.
